>Description:
Too restrictive permissions (0700) prevent regular users from using the installed binary, though
no root privs are needed to bind to ports >1024.  I personally find that 0750 works better.
>How-To-Repeat:
Try to run it as user `foo' after fresh install.
>Fix:
On the line 20 of files/patch-aa, s/0700/0750/.
